php - 模仿 CodeIgniter 中退出的使用的类似方法

标签 php codeigniter codeigniter-2 codeigniter-url

我是 CodeIgniter 的新手。之前我开发了一个登录脚本,通过使用类似于以下内容的行,可以使登录页面看起来与用户正在查看的页面相同:

include('loginpage.php');
exit;

但是对于 CodeIgniter,以下结果不会显示任何内容,因为输出类的功能尚未完全执行:

$this->load->view('loginpage');
exit;

所以我的问题是:是否有其他方法可以模仿我之前方法的功能?最终,我更喜欢这种方法,因为对于用户来说,他们似乎位于他们请求的页面上,只有他们需要先登录才能看到它(如果他们还没有登录)。

最佳答案

尝试:

$msj= $this->load->view('loginpage',$data,true);
exit($msj);

关于php - 模仿 CodeIgniter 中退出的使用的类似方法,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7706178/

相关文章:

查询中的 PHP 函数

php - Laravel 5 具有多个变量的 View 编辑器

php - 代码点火器。如何在表 int() 列中插入时间戳格式的字符串值

php - 快速检查或添加到数据库

php - 根据之前的下拉选择动态填充最多 3 个下拉菜单

sql - 从 PHP 到 Microsoft SQL SERVER 执行存储过程的问题

php - 如何使用 php 在一张 excel 中自定义 excel 数据的两张表?

mysql - Codeigniter:从三个表生成学生成绩单

php - 使用 Codeigniter 获取登录用户的所有消息以及每条消息的所有答案

php - 在 Codeigniter 中选择带有限制的结果中的 SUM